## About
|
||||
A Gantt chart is a bar chart that visually illustrates a project's schedule, tasks, and dependencies. With Frappe Gantt, you can easily build beautiful Gantt charts, with extensive levels of configurability.
|
||||
|
||||
You can use it anywhere from hobby projects to tracking the goals of your team at the worksplace.
|
||||
|
||||
[ERPNext](https://erpnext.com/) uses Frappe Gantt.
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
## Motivation
|
||||
We at Frappe built Gantt after realizing that although Gantt charts are everywhere, there was no open source implementation.
|
||||
|
||||
Today, we pride ourselves on having the most aesthetically pleasing _and_ powerful Gantt library on the market - except it's free!
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
## Key Features
|
||||
- A wide variety of modes - be it day, hour, or year, you have it. Or add your own modes!
|
||||
- Easily ignore time periods from your tasks' progress calculation
|
||||
- An incredible amount of configurability: spacing, edit access, labels, you can control it all.
|
||||
- Multi-lingual support
|
||||
- Powerful API to integrate Frappe Gantt into your product.

### Publishing
|
||||
|
||||
If you have publishing rights (Frappe Team), follow these steps to publish a new version.
|
||||
|
||||
Assuming the last commit (or a couple of commits) were enhancements or fixes,
|
||||
|
||||
1. Run `yarn build`
|
||||
|
||||
This will generate files in the `dist/` folder. These files need to be committed.
|
||||
|
||||
1. Run `yarn publish`
|
||||
1. Type the new version at the prompt
|
||||
|
||||
Depending on the type of change, you can either bump the patch version or the minor version.
|
||||
For e.g.,
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
0.5.0 -> 0.6.0 (minor version bump)
|
||||
0.5.0 -> 0.5.1 (patch version bump)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
1. Now, there will be a commit named after the version you just entered. Include the generated files in `dist/` folder as part of this commit by running the command:
|
||||
```
|
||||
git add dist
|
||||
git commit --amend
|
||||
git push origin master
|
||||
```
